Frequently Asked Questions about Bridgewater
How much are Studio apartments in Bridgewater?
There are currently 28 Studio Apartments in Bridgewater with rent ranges from $1,650 to $2,440 with an average price of $1,963.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bridgewater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bridgewater ranges from $1,300 to $5,324 with an average monthly rent of $2,386.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bridgewater c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bridgewater range from $1,558 to $4,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,881.
How expensive are Bridgewater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 25 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bridgewater on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,000 to $5,025 - averaging $3,344 for the location.
